Description: Sequence-indexed T-DNA insertion line generated by vacuum infiltration of Columbia (Col) plants with Agrobacterium tumefaciens vector pROK2; kanamycin was employed for selection of plants carrying a T-DNA (please note that in many lines, the kan resistance trait has been cosuppressed, so that insertion plants may not be kanamycin resistant); each T1 transformant has been maintained individually at SALK; the DNA sequence of each T-DNA flanking region was generated from seedlings grown from the same sample of seeds as that provided for distribution (T3). NOTE: kanamycin resistance gene may be silenced; PCR- or hybridization-based segregation analysis is required to confirm presence of insertion; may be segregating for phenotypes that are not linked to the insertion; may have additional insertions potentially segregating.
